The face-to-face ITU Asia-Pacific Centre of Excellence (ITU ASP CoE) Training on " Traffic engineering and advanced wireless network planning? will be conducted from 17-19 October 2018 at Suva, Fiji.

This face-to-face training is organized jointly by the International Telecommunication Union, Pacific Islands Telecommunication Association and the Ministry of Digital Economy and Society (Thailand) as part of the Broadband Access programme under the auspices of the ITU Centres of Excellence for Asia-Pacific Region. The training is hosted by the Department of Communication (Government of Fiji) and is supported by the Department of Communications and the Arts (Government of Australia). The training will be delivered in English language.

The training will be preceded by the PITA Telecoms Digital Strategy Forum, which will be held from 15-16 October 2018 at the same venue.
